I have been wondering whether it is better to keep food in the coop or out of the coop. Right now I put the food and water outside during the day (the chick feeder) and put both inside at night to try to get them in the coop. But it is not really working, they won't go in coop by themselves.

So I have been wondering whether to bother putting both in at night.

What works for you all??
 
food and water outside during the spring -summer and part of the fall months up here North-east Mass. during the winter I feed them inside on really cold and frezzing temps and snow weather , on the nice days in the winter they eat out side ..... most of the times the chickens will head for the inside when it gets dark , only the young one's are not sure where to go , but they will follow suit in time

Food outside during day (in barn at night) Water in both areas day and night this way it doesn't matter where they are at they have it when they want it but I also time feed them they get food 1 hour 3times a day the rest of the time it is scratch and whatever treat I have for them theis way the ymove around and don't stay just in the coop all day eating.


In bad weather it is always inside with them.
So I would say it is your choice if you feel thay are eating to much cut back on the time you leave the food in there for them not enough then just leave it in all day as I siad it is your choice.
 
In. At least for us, it rains FAR too much to keep food out. The water is out, and gets refilled both naturally and by myself all the time, and their feed is left in the coop, but they rarely eat it, as there's plenty to eat outside.

For us its feeder & waterer inside, extra waterer outside. All treats are fed outside, except on the very harshest Winter days.
